Step 1
Cook pasta according to package directions. Drain and set aside.
Step 2
In a small bowl or a liquid measuring cup mix together the sauce ingredients: soy sauce, chinese wine, toasted sesame oil, agave nectar, curry powder, white pepper, garlic, and chilies. Set aside.
Step 3
Heat a wok over high heat. Add the oil and onion when hot and fry 1 1/2 - 2 minutes, stirring constantly, until the onion is charred and soft.
Step 4
Add the cabbage and cook for about 2 minutes, stirring almost constantly, until it is wilted and lightly charred. Add the sugar snap peas, carrots, and bell pepper and cook for 1 - 1 1/2 minutes until the vegetables have charred a little.
Step 5
Add the noodles and the sauce and fry for about 2 minutes, stirring constantly to distribute sauce and prevent sticking.
Step 6
Squeeze fresh lime wedges over the noodles to serve and garnish with sliced scallions or additional minced chiles if desired.
